Things worth knowing about Queen Annes County


46,986 residents live across 13 ZIPs covering 350 sq mi, served by 13 distinct USPS-recognized cities.

Population moved from 43,265 to 46,986 from 2014 to 2024 — a +8.6% change. 7 ZIPs gained residents, 4 lost.

The county's wealthiest ZIP 21638 (Grasonville, $140,086 median) and poorest ZIP 21623 (Church Hill, $78,345) are 17.6 miles apart — a 1.8× income gap across local geography.

Median home values vary 3.6× across this county — from $160,200 in 21628 (Crumpton) to $569,200 in 21638 (Grasonville).

Density varies 14× across the county — from 41 people/sq mi in 21607 (Barclay) to 586 in 21666 (Stevensville).

Educational attainment ranges from 14.0% bachelor's+ in 21607 (Barclay) to 46.7% in 21638 (Grasonville) — the breadth of educational profiles across the area.

Within Maryland, this is the #18 most populous of 24 counties and ranks #11 for median household income with the #4 fastest decade growth .

Hosts 1 single-entity Unique ZIP: 21690Usa Fulfillment .

Weighted by population, the typical household earns about $116,802 across the county — reflecting what a typical resident sees, not a simple ZIP average.

38.2% of adults age 25+ hold a bachelor's degree or higher (12,978 of 33,972 reporting).

10 Standard delivery, 2 PO Box only, 1 single-entity Unique ZIPs serve this county.
